Abstract

A variable booster device of a pneumatic regenerative system of a motorized vehicle is in fluid communication with a pneumatic device of the system. The variable booster device includes a main body and a plate slidingly coupled to the main body. The main body includes an inlet, an outlet, and an interior cavity. The plate is reconfigurable between a first configuration, where the outlet is a first size, and a second configuration, where the outlet is a second size. The variable booster device pressurizes the air a first amount when the plate is in the first configuration and pressurizes the air a second amount when the plate is in the second configuration, where the second amount is greater than the first amount. Disposed within the interior cavity is a first helical screw rotor and a second helical screw rotor. The two helical screw rotors are intermeshed with one another. The pressurized air is fed from the outlet of the variable booster device to the pneumatic device of the pneumatic regenerative system to be further pressurized by the pneumatic device and then stored for later use in the system.
